Cannibal guy is very polite and lets him go, breaks generics stereotype of cannibals. Normally if we enter their homes we would end up as dinner. Hannibal Lector is closest to this guy. Urbane, polite and neat. Had a sense of humor. Over exaggerated evil laugh, advertised rather than hunt
The boss seems ridiculous, childlike, called Bruce Wayne (Batman), inherited his wealth/company, stupid.
